Carrie Lee Cokley Crank Cephus, lovingly called “Dell/Mama/Mother, Ma-Ma or Grandma”, was born on May 13, 1933 in Kingstree, South Carolina. After time, she made her way to California and of course, Baltimore, MD. Living 92 years and 352 days, She impacted countless individuals personally, professionally, and academically. She was a feisty leader but one of the sweetest givers on the planet.

Mrs. Cephus was a member of Cherry Hill United Methodist Church for well over 60 years. Under the leadership of Rev. James H. Wooten, Mrs. Carrie lead many church auxiliaries such as the Ways & Means Committee, food distribution services, pastoral parish, and contributor of creating the daycare just to name a few. With a limited 8th grade education, she was able to acquire positions in companies such as Baltimore Luggage, Southern Bell/Western Electric, Baltimore City Schools, and Martin Marietta/Locheed Martin. She believed in the importance of not only maintaining a job but education as well. At the age of 69, she went back to school to get her G.E.D and immediately enrolled into BCCC, where she obtained her Associates of Arts Degree at the age of 71. When asked why she decided to return to school, she often expressed that if she could do it at 71, then no one in her family could have an excuse not to.
